SCOUT siblings chosen to attend a prestigious event in Japan next year have been busy fund-raising.
Since being picked for the 23rd World Scout Jamboree, James and Ellie Fordham from Alcester have completed a sponsored walk, run a cake sale, entered the town’s Pram Race and taken part in the Alcester Street Market and Family Fun Day.
The pair need to raise £3,045 each to go along to the event, which will be attended by only 36 Scouts from Warwickshire.
Their next activity will see them asking shoppers in Stratford’s Maybird Centre to guess how many balloons there are in a Honda from Listers tomorrow (Saturday). The winner gets to drive the car for a week.
